pscholte- don't forget to keep your oil selection light, as the oil cooler lines in your 2.7t k03 turbos are rather small diameter, smaller than on the 1.8t, for instance.
 
Your first batch could possibly have up to 9ppm of iron in it, but your second batch would most likely be closer to only 3ppm, as it's similar to the batch number I had tested, which was M030426B T/W1240607


I've found an even newer batch number on the shelves here now and I'm going to assume it's got little to no iron in it now, so I will be mixing my other stuff with this new stuff in a 50/50 ratio.

So for those of you looking for this oil, try and buy the batch numbers which begin in M03 instead of M02. The stuff I recently found begins with M033.
